I first began working with INFINITY 27 as a freelancer, contracted to develop a VR experience for UKAEA about Tokamak reactors. The project included several interactive stages, one of which allowed users to assemble the different parts of the reactor. The project lasted around three months, and I helped deliver a fully functional experience that could be side-loaded onto an Oculus Quest.
Although a short project, it allowed me to apply the VR optimisation and interaction techniques I had already learned on previous projects, focusing on implementing reliable systems and smooth user interactions.
